D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ter

Ingredients:

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Ingredients

Coffee: It exfoliates dry skin and makes it feel silky smooth. It effectively removes dry and dead skin cells and gives a polish texture to the skin. It is a rich source of antioxidants that keep skin youthful and healthy. It enhances blood circulation and removes dirt from the skin. It keeps skin soft and nourished.

Curd: Curd is an ingredient which keeps skin extremely moisturized. It is a hydrating exfoliator that removes dead skin cells. Curd fights against pimples and acne too. It reduces blemishes and works as a spot cleanser. It makes skin healthy and glowing.

Turmeric: Turmeric is an antibacterial agent. Turmeric helps to heal acne, as well as keeps the skin look young and fresh. It has natural skin brightening properties that provide a healthy glow. It contains many antioxidants; it is great for ageing skin.

Olive Oil: Olive oil is extremely moisturizing and provides deep nourishment to the skin. It’s rich antioxidant properties keep skin youthful and healthy. It cures dryness and repairs the skin texture to make it smooth, soft and glowing. It suits most of the skin types.

Procedure:

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Curd in Bowl
1. First, take 2-3 tablespoons (according to your requirement) of curd in a bowl and blend the curd well to make it smooth like a cream.

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Adding Turmeric
2. Next, add 1 spoon of turmeric powder to it and combine them well.

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Adding Coffee Powder
3. Then add 2 tablespoons of coffee powder to the bowl and mix the ingredients. Make sure the consistency remains creamy and it should be blended well.

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Add Olive Oil
4. Finally, add 1 spoon of olive oil and mix that well with the mixture.

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Final Scrub
5. Body Scrub is ready to use now.

DIY Cleansing and Moisturising Body Scrub for Winter Scrub On Hand
6. Apply it directly on your body and gently massage it for few minutes to clean your body. Then rinse it off. You can store it for 5 days in a refrigerator. It might dry out like a coffee dust, but you have to add some rose water and use it smoothly.
